What Does PRX Stand for Tissot?

Tissot is one of the most respected Swiss watch brands, known for its heritage, precision, and innovation. The brand’s iconic models, which combine the best of Swiss craftsmanship with modern design, have earned it a place at the forefront of the watch industry. Among Tissot’s many notable lines, the PRX collection has garnered considerable attention in recent years. But what exactly does “PRX” stand for Tissot, and why has this collection become so popular? In this article, we will explore the meaning behind the name PRX, its origins, its design features, and why it has captured the hearts of watch enthusiasts worldwide.

The Origins of the PRX Collection

Before we delve into what PRX stands for, it’s essential to understand the history behind the collection itself. The Tissot PRX was first introduced in the 1970s, a period known for its bold watch designs, especially in the world of luxury watches. During this time, Tissot, like many other Swiss watchmakers, was experimenting with new materials, styles, and technologies to meet the growing demand for modern, reliable, and stylish timepieces.

The PRX collection was part of a trend of watches that blended sleek, futuristic aesthetics with Swiss precision. The Tissot PRX was designed with a minimalist approach, featuring a clean and simple dial, a distinctive integrated bracelet, and a case made from high-quality materials such as stainless steel. The design was meant to be modern, functional, and stylish, appealing to both men and women who appreciated high-quality craftsmanship.

In the early 2000s, Tissot began reintroducing some of its classic models. The PRX, having had a cult following among collectors, was reissued in a modernized version that still honored its original 1970s design. This new version of the PRX caught the attention of a new generation of watch lovers, leading to its widespread popularity today.

What Does “PRX” Stand For?

Now, let’s get to the heart of the matter: What does PRX stand for? Tissot has never explicitly explained the meaning behind the acronym “PRX,” leaving some room for speculation among fans and collectors.

1. “PR” – A Reference to “Precision” and “Revolution”

One popular theory is that the “PR” in PRX stands for “Precision” or “Professional” because the watch is designed to reflect Tissot’s commitment to precision. Tissot, as part of the Swatch Group, has built its reputation on providing watches that are both affordable and precise. By incorporating “PR” into the name, Tissot might be signaling that this collection is built with accuracy in mind, combining Swiss watchmaking heritage with the need for reliable, functional timepieces.

Another interpretation of the “PR” could be linked to the word “Revolution.” During the 1970s, the world of watchmaking was undergoing a significant shift due to the rise of quartz movements, and many Swiss watchmakers were experimenting with new technologies. The PRX collection was part of Tissot’s contribution to this revolution, with its modern design and integration of materials that were innovative at the time.

2. “X” – A Symbol of Design and Innovation

The “X” at the end of the name could symbolize the innovative, cross-cutting design of the PRX collection. It is often seen as a letter that represents “cross,” “crossover,” or even “extreme,” suggesting a watch that stands at the intersection of form and function. The use of the letter “X” gives the name a modern, dynamic feel, which perfectly reflects the design of the PRX. The PRX models blend traditional Swiss watchmaking with a contemporary design language, bridging the gap between classic elegance and modern styling.

ADVERTISEMENT

This use of the letter “X” also alludes to the collection’s strong visual appeal. The PRX collection is known for its clean, geometric design, especially the integrated bracelet that features smooth links and a perfectly polished finish. The “X” emphasizes the collection’s cutting-edge approach to design and its ability to stand out in the crowded world of luxury watches.

Design Features of the Tissot PRX Collection

The PRX collection, whether the original models from the 1970s or the more recent reissues, is defined by its distinctive design features. These elements not only set the PRX apart from other models but also contribute to its growing popularity. Let’s explore the key design characteristics of the Tissot PRX.

1. Integrated Bracelet

One of the most striking features of the PRX is its integrated bracelet. This style was very popular in the 1970s and became a hallmark of many luxury watches. Unlike traditional watch designs where the strap or bracelet is attached separately to the case, the integrated bracelet seamlessly flows into the watch case, giving the entire watch a more uniform, cohesive look.

The bracelet on the Tissot PRX is typically made from high-quality stainless steel, contributing to its durability and comfort. The links are designed to be smooth and ergonomically shaped, allowing the bracelet to sit comfortably on the wrist. The integrated bracelet not only adds to the watch’s modern aesthetic but also ensures a tight and secure fit.

2. Minimalist Dial

The dial of the Tissot PRX is characterized by a clean and simple layout. Most models feature a straightforward three-hand configuration, with a central hour hand, minute hand, and a small second hand. The dial is free from unnecessary complications, creating a look that is elegant and timeless.

The PRX dial is often available in a variety of colors, including classic silver, black, blue, and even green, allowing for customization to suit individual tastes. Some models also feature a textured dial with a horizontal pattern, adding a subtle touch of sophistication. The large, easy-to-read indices and markers further enhance the watch’s minimalist charm.

3. Case and Crystal

The case of the Tissot PRX is typically made from stainless steel, which provides both strength and a polished, refined appearance. The case is generally rectangular with rounded corners, giving it a sleek, angular look. The finish is often brushed or polished, depending on the model.

The crystal covering the dial is usually sapphire, known for its scratch resistance and durability. This ensures that the watch remains in pristine condition even after years of wear. The flat sapphire crystal also contributes to the watch’s clean, modern look.

4. Versatility

Another appealing aspect of the Tissot PRX is its versatility. The design of the watch makes it suitable for a wide range of occasions, from casual outings to formal events. The clean lines and understated elegance allow it to pair well with both business attire and more relaxed outfits. This versatility is one of the reasons why the PRX collection has become a favorite among watch enthusiasts of all ages.

5. Size Options

The Tissot PRX is available in different sizes, catering to both men and women. The case size typically ranges from 35mm to 40mm in diameter, with some models offering slightly larger or smaller options. This ensures that the PRX is a comfortable fit for a variety of wrist sizes, making it an accessible choice for many watch lovers.

The PRX’s Quartz and Automatic Movements

In terms of movement, the Tissot PRX offers both quartz and automatic models. The quartz models are powered by the reliable ETA 955.412 movement, known for its accuracy and long-lasting performance. These models are particularly popular due to their affordability, as quartz movements are less expensive to produce than mechanical ones.

On the other hand, the automatic models of the PRX are powered by the ETA Powermatic 80 movement, which boasts an impressive 80-hour power reserve. This movement is highly regarded for its precision and smooth operation, making it a great option for those who prefer the craftsmanship of an automatic movement.

Why is the Tissot PRX So Popular?

The Tissot PRX has gained significant popularity in recent years, and this can be attributed to several factors:

1. Nostalgia for the 1970s

The resurgence of interest in vintage-style watches has played a key role in the PRX’s rise to fame. The 1970s were a defining decade for watch design, with many iconic models emerging during this period. The PRX captures the essence of this era with its integrated bracelet, clean lines, and minimalist aesthetic. For those who appreciate vintage design, the PRX is a perfect modern reinterpretation of a classic style.

2. Affordable Luxury

One of the biggest appeals of the Tissot PRX is its affordability. While many Swiss luxury watches can be prohibitively expensive, the PRX offers an accessible price point for those looking for quality and design without the hefty price tag. Tissot is known for delivering Swiss-made watches with excellent craftsmanship at a more affordable price than some of its competitors, making the PRX an attractive option for those new to the world of luxury timepieces.

3. Modern Appeal

Despite its vintage roots, the PRX also has a strong contemporary appeal. The clean, minimalist design and the versatility of the watch make it ideal for modern fashion sensibilities. Its ability to adapt to both casual and formal settings adds to its popularity among younger watch collectors and fashion-forward individuals.

4. Tissot’s Reputation

Tissot has long been a respected name in the watch industry. Known for producing high-quality watches with a reputation for precision and innovation, Tissot brings a level of trustworthiness to the PRX collection. For those who value Swiss craftsmanship, the Tissot PRX is a reliable and stylish option.

Conclusion

The Tissot PRX is a remarkable collection that combines Swiss watchmaking heritage with modern design and precision. While the true meaning of “PRX” remains open to interpretation, the collection itself stands as a testament to Tissot’s ability to innovate and capture the spirit of different eras in watchmaking. Whether you are drawn to the PRX for its nostalgic 1970s design, its affordability, or its timeless appeal, one thing is clear: Tissot has created a watch that resonates with a diverse group of watch enthusiasts.
